I would never have thought to try cuttings in winter, but someone told me they had good luck with it and i tried it one year...just have to make sure the ground isn't frozen....and i have 4 out of 5 varieties root right in the ground. the only thing i did was make a hole with a pencil....dip cutting in hormone powder..insert in hole and press down soil...so easy.
